Understanding Composite Doors

Composite doors are made from a combination of products, including wood, plastic, and in some cases metal. These products are developed to simulate the look of traditional wood doors while using improved durability and resistance to weathering. Composite doors are known for their energy effectiveness, security, and low maintenance requirements.

When to Replace Composite Door Panels

Before diving into the replacement process, it's crucial to figure out whether your composite door panels need to be replaced. Here are some signs that show it may be time for a panel swap:

  • Visible Damage: Cracks, dents, or chips in the panel.
  • Weathering: Fading, peeling, or warping due to direct exposure to the components.
  • Security Concerns: Loose or jeopardized panels that position a security threat.
  • Visual Preferences: Desire to alter the appearance of your door to match new interior or exterior decor.

Tools and Materials Needed

Before you start the replacement procedure, gather the following tools and products:

  • New Composite Door Panel: Ensure it matches the size and design of your existing panel.
  • Screwdriver: For removing screws and fasteners.
  • Rubber Mallet: For gently tapping the panel into location.
  • Energy Knife: For cutting any excess product.
  • Caulk Gun and Silicone Sealant: For sealing spaces and ensuring a watertight fit.
  • Safety Gear: Gloves and shatterproof glass for protection.

Step-by-Step Guide to Composite Door Panel Replacement

Prepare the Work Area

  • Clear the area around the door to guarantee a safe and unblocked work area.
  • Set a drop fabric or protective covering to protect the flooring.

Eliminate the Existing Panel

  • Utilize a screwdriver to get rid of the screws or fasteners that secure the panel to the door frame.
  • Thoroughly pry the panel out of the frame, using a rubber mallet if necessary to prevent damaging the surrounding structure.

Check the Door Frame

  • Inspect the door frame for any damage or wear. If required, repair or change any damaged components.
  • Clean the frame to make sure a smooth and tidy surface for the new panel.

Install the New Panel

  • Position the new composite door panel in the frame, guaranteeing it is centered and lined up.
  • Use a rubber mallet to gently tap the panel into location, making sure it is secure and flush with the frame.

Secure the Panel

  • Reattach the screws or fasteners, tightening them firmly however not a lot that they cause the panel to warp.
  • Verify the positioning and fit of the panel to ensure it is level and secure.

Seal the Gaps

  • Use a bead of silicone sealant around the edges of the panel to create a watertight seal.
  • Smooth the sealant with a caulk smoothing tool to make sure a clean and professional finish.

Check the Door

  • Open and close the door several times to ensure it operates smoothly and the brand-new panel is appropriately installed.
  • Look for any spaces or leaks and make adjustments as required.

Last Touches

  • Clean the door and panel with a mild cleaning agent and water to eliminate any dirt or residue.
  • Use a fresh coat of paint or stain, if wanted, to match the rest of your door and exterior.
